Output 573c6a330003b9128ab77abab89645875c34c30f42cdf308f7aec1d29cca6cf5:1

value
23816180
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e257b41b6c6bdfd936734e3901b6eefc536e8dcf OP_EQUAL
address
3NKoheSwPwb5ngDnGtGprFi1uF4LKWWBFm
transaction
573c6a330003b9128ab77abab89645875c34c30f42cdf308f7aec1d29cca6cf5
confirmations
521786
spent
true